Sterling has been an active and dedicated volunteer with Big Brothers Big Sisters of Central Iowa since 2018, when he was first matched with Little Brother Adebayor. Their match lasted an impressive five years, continuing until Adebayor graduated from high school in 2023—a testament to Sterling’s commitment and consistency. In recognition of his impact, Sterling was honored as Big Brother of the Year in 2021.
That commitment to showing up didn’t end when one match did—it simply grew into his next match with Little Brother Joey.
Since being matched in October 2024, Sterling has shown up for Joey with remarkable consistency, intention, and heart. From high school football and basketball games and BBBS events to simple days walking at Gray’s Lake or grabbing a bite to eat, Sterling has created steady, meaningful moments that help Joey grow. Over time, Joey has come out of his shell, becoming more confident, more expressive, and more comfortable sharing his thoughts.
Sterling leads with patience, positivity, and genuine care, teaching Joey everyday skills like manners, social confidence, and trust. He stays engaged with Joey’s family, actively seeks out ways to support him, and consistently advocates for BBBS in his workplace and community.
Their match reflects exactly what lasting mentoring impact looks like: consistency, connection, and the willingness to keep showing up.
